Ammonia gas and carbon dioxide gas react to form aqueous urea (NH2CoNH2) and water. What volume of ammonia at 25 degrees celcius and 1.5 atm pressure is needed to produce 500 g of urea?

Answers

Answered by R.
PV = nRT where R = 0.0821 atm.L / K.mol

NH2CONH2 = (14.01)(2)+(1.01)(4)+(12.01)+(16) = 60.07
n = 500 g/60.07 g = 8.32362244049 = 8.3236 mol of NH2CONH2 = 16.6472 mol of NH3


(1.5)V = (16.6472)(0.0821 atm L / K mol)(298.15 K)
(1.5)V = 407.492076028
V = 271.661384019
271.66 L of ammonia gas
